justin 7f62fd7645 CI: skip GitHub-specific workflows on Gitea Actions; add workflow_dispatch
Gitea reads .github/workflows/ for compatibility, so without guards it
tries to run the release and wiki-sync workflows on Gitea too - which
fail because they use softprops/action-gh-release@v2 (GitHub-only) and
push to GitHub-hosted wiki URLs.

Add `if: github.server_url == 'https://github.com'` to the
release-builder and wiki-sync jobs so Gitea no-ops them. ci.yml
(plain dotnet build + test) still runs on both, and now also accepts
workflow_dispatch so it can be triggered by hand to verify a self-
hosted runner is picking up jobs.

name: Sync Wiki
on:
push:
branches: [main]
paths:
- 'docs/**'
- 'scripts/sync-wiki.ps1'
- '.github/workflows/wiki-sync.yml'
workflow_dispatch:
jobs:
sync:
# Gitea reads .github/workflows/ for compatibility, but this workflow
# pushes to a GitHub-hosted wiki. Skip on non-GitHub runners; the Gitea
# wiki is synced separately via scripts/sync-wiki.ps1.
if: github.server_url == 'https://github.com'
runs-on: windows-latest
permissions:
contents: write
steps:
- uses: actions/checkout@v4
- name: Sync docs/ to GitHub wiki
shell: pwsh
env:
GH_TOKEN: 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}
run: |
$repo = '${{ github.repository }}'
$wikiUrl = "https://x-access-token:$env:GH_TOKEN@github.com/$repo.wiki.git"
./scripts/sync-wiki.ps1 -WikiUrl $wikiUrl
